Cancer treatment has evolved considerably over the past decade, with significant improvements in chemotherapy, targeted therapies, and immunotherapy. Alongside these advances, supportive care has become an essential part of comprehensive oncology treatment. Managing chemotherapy-induced nausea and vomiting (CINV) is critical because it improves patient comfort, treatment adherence, and overall quality of life. Aprepitant injection has become an important antiemetic therapy used to prevent nausea and vomiting associated with chemotherapy and certain surgical procedures.
